Safety/Flammability/Storage Data from acute toxicity studies has demonstrated that Vertrel® SDG has low toxicity. It has a calculated AEL (Acceptable Exposure Limit) of 193 ppm based on its individual components. AEL is an airborne inhalation exposure limit established by DuPont™ that specifies time-weighted average concentrations to which nearly all workers may be repeatedly exposed without adverse effects. The calculated AEL is in accordance with ACGIH formulas for TLVs for mixtures. Vertrel® SDG is a slight skin and eye irritant and has low acute inhalation toxicity. DuPont™ Vertrel® SDG exhibits no closed cup or open cup flash point and is not classified as a flammable liquid by NFPA or DOT. The product is volatile, and if allowed to evaporate and mix with air, the vapor may become flammable. Flash point data and vapor flammability limits in air are shown in the table. Users also need to consider the possibility of vapor flammability of this product to determine guidelines for its safe handling in all other parts of the user's operations. For example, when opening a partially-filled container that has been stored, treat the gas/air mixture as if it is flammable. DuPont™ Vertrel® SDG is thermally stable and does not oxidize or degrade during storage. Store in a clean, dry area. Protect from freezing temperatures. If solvent is stored below -10ºC (14ºF), mix prior to use. Do not allow stored product to exceed 52ºC (125ºF) to prevent leakage or potential rupture of container from pressure and expansion.
